I was staged IIIb also. I received chemo and radiation. Finished chemo and radiation in March and May 29 I had my left lung removed. He said it was the most hardest lung removed for him because of the scar tissue. I had already decided if some will take my lung I was going to do it. I stayed in the hospital for 6 days and it really was not that bad for me. I was in the mall 2 days after I left the hospital. I did have my oxygen but oh well. I am doing pretty good. My strength is not were I want to be but I will get my strength back one day. Keep us posted and ask any questions.
